How health has changed in Chelmsford: 2015 to 2021
Content originally from Office for National Statistics Chelmsford's best score across all subdomains is 114.4 for health relating to "behavioural risk factors". "Behavioural risk factors" looks at alcohol misuse, drug misuse, healthy eating, physical activity, sedentary behaviour, sexually transmitted infections, and smoking. Noise pollution: mapping the health impacts of transportation noise in England
Content originally from GOV.UK Noise can have a significant impact on our health, beyond just being annoying or disturbing sleep. The UK Health Security Agency (UKHSA) has conducted a new study to better understand how noise can affect health and wellbeing.
